The GERmanium Detector Array readout: status and developments

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2007
abstract:
The GERmanium Detector Array, GERDA, is designed to search for neutrinoless double beta decay of 76Ge. In this work the status of the R&D on cryogenics front-end circuits of gamma spectrometry class conducted in the framework of GERDA is reviewed.
